Strategic Position
Chongqing Hifuture Information Technology Co., Ltd. is a Chinese company primarily engaged in the research, development, production, and sales of smart grid equipment and solutions. It operates in the power automation and energy management sectors, providing products such as power monitoring systems, smart meters, and distribution automation devices. The company serves state grid corporations, power utilities, and industrial clients in China, leveraging its technological expertise to support grid modernization and energy efficiency initiatives. Its competitive position is tied to domestic infrastructure investment and policy support for smart grid development, though it operates in a highly competitive and fragmented market with several larger players.
